Document Transport — Signed Contracts. Scope: originals moving between the Marlow Street and Ashfell offices. Use sealed pouches only; one pouch per contract set. Log departure and arrival times in the transit book. No overnight holds. Drivers must not leave pouches unattended in vehicles. For each run, the courier hand-over instruction is listed directly below.

handover note for yagef-bagep: the drudor pelius courier leaves the kasdor zorvan norir ledger at gate 8016 under passcode 755406

## Escalation — CoilCount Planner

If CoilCount stops emitting restock routes by 06:30 local, first check the telemetry ingest queue — it's the usual suspect. Drain and replay if lag exceeds an hour. Still stuck? Don't hand-craft routes; techs will get duplicate stops. Wake the planner team lead instead — they're fine with it, promise. For anything weirder, ping the escalation inbox directly.

escalation mailbox, bafog-fafog: ulador@paliqlabs.internal

☐ Key ceremony step 4 — Paylark export cutover. Before we rotate the signing key for the new Paylark v3 payroll export format, double-check that the old fixed-width files have stopped flowing from the Brindlewood batch host. Support folks: if anyone calls about mangled pay stubs this week, it's almost certainly the format change, not the key. Once both custodians confirm the rotation, record the recovery passphrase below in the sealed log.

unlock words, hahip-yagef: zorok-novmir-zorix-silax

Handover for the sync: the translation-string extraction script (`polyglot-sweep`) now scans the Wrenfield app tree nightly and files diffs against the string catalog. Known gaps: it misses strings built via concatenation, and pluralization rules for the Velsa locale are stubbed. Output lands in the localization queue automatically. Ongoing ownership of the script and its backlog passes to the engineer named below.

named custodian: Belius Casath Ulaix Sorius